Output 50bb00059754df845f58549f74618113edb347527345d2ea69214f7010313633:2

value
2966000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c6f032ae4a60c2735a894e4607c5335964605ce OP_EQUAL
address
34HMqBy9e7XayC1vja1R46CVX5SXKNksA7
transaction
50bb00059754df845f58549f74618113edb347527345d2ea69214f7010313633
confirmations
527980
spent
true